§ 501 Eligible Voters
Pursuant to Article VIII, Section 7 of the Constitution, persons must meet the following requirements in order to be eligible to vote in tribal elections:

A. Membership. Persons must be enrolled tribal members.
B. Age. Persons must be eighteen (18) years or older on the date of the election.

[Legislative History: Enacted by Resolution No. 97-12, 3/19/1997; Amendment and Restatement by Resolution No. 2019-162, 12/18/2019]
